Gloucestershire Cricket is proud to announce the opening of their brand new Thatchers Café at the Seat Unique Stadium.

Serving artisan Clifton coffee made by their skilled baristas, the Thatchers Café provides a stunning setting for your morning meet-up with friends or lunch out of the office with colleagues. Overlooking the outfield of one of the most loved venues in English Cricket and located just off Gloucester Road, the Thatchers Café offers a unique experience for coffee lovers.

Aside from serving variety of hot and cold soft drinks, the Thatchers Café is also a licensed bar and boasts a delicious selection of snacks, fruit and freshly made sandwiches to accompany your chosen drink. From flapjacks to muffins, scotch eggs to bacon rolls and croissants to cakes the café offers a light bite to suit any occasion and appetite while also providing vegan and vegetarian options.

With a fast and reliable Wi-Fi connection the café can also act as the ideal place to hotspot away from the office or your usual work from home environment. While enjoying the calming surroundings of Gloucestershire Cricket’s home ground, you can kick back and relax in one of the café’s comfy sofas or pull up a chair elsewhere in the large seating area with a perfect view of the Seat Unique Stadium.

The Thatchers Café is open 8.15am - 4pm Monday to Friday on non-matchdays, and will be open in-line with ground opening hours on match days. 

You do not have to be a Gloucestershire Cricket Member to visit the Thatchers Café on non-matchdays, it is open to the general public and is easily accessible from the Nevil Road entrance to the ground. Match-day access, however, will be restricted to supporters and Members who have purchased tickets to watch The Shire in action.
